Detailed Bias Analysis

Analyzing...
Leans Progressive

Primary

The series focuses on the apolitical themes of artistic ambition and the challenges of creating a Broadway musical, with its central conflicts revolving around individual talent, collaboration, and interpersonal drama rather than explicit political ideologies.

The series features a visibly diverse ensemble cast, including prominent minority and LGBTQ+ characters, reflecting the varied landscape of the Broadway world. Its narrative focuses on the dramatic challenges of creating a musical, integrating diverse identities and relationships into the story without explicitly critiquing traditional identities or making DEI themes central to its core plot.

Secondary

Smash features prominent gay characters, including lead composer Tom Levitt, whose identity and relationships are portrayed with dignity and complexity. The show integrates LGBTQ+ lives into its narrative without relying on harmful stereotypes, presenting their experiences as integral and respected aspects of the story.

The television series "Smash" does not include any identifiable transsexual characters or themes. Its narrative focuses on the creation of a Broadway musical, primarily exploring the lives and careers of the cast and crew without engaging with transgender identity or experiences.
